Back Cover Information

Learn the Fascinating True Story of Fabrics in America .... Make Your Own Period Quilts

  • The comprehensive guide to fabrics and their influence on American quilts, from the machine age to the atomic age
  • Essential companion volume to America's Printed Fabrics 1770-1890
  • Includes 9 quilt projects inspired by vintage quilt designs and fabrics
  • Packed with historic photos, stories and insights into the role of fabrics in everyday life

 

About the Author

Barbara Brackman has been crazy about fabric since she was a child in the 1950s she spent a good deal of her youth watching old movies on television while she embroidered dish towels. She has written many books about fabric and quilts, among them America's Printed Fabrics: 1770-1890. She has also written about quilts and the Civil War, the most recent book being Facts & Fabrications: Unraveling the History of Quilts & Slavery. She was a founding member of the American Quilt Study Group and is an honoree of the Quilters' Hall of Fame. She designs reproduction fabrics.
